*Take the cooling elements from an ordinary household freezer (-22C).Put the right number of cooling elements in the transport boxPrecooling:

You can put the cooling elements in the transport box when you leave the main hospital, and store them in the transport box approx. 0-4 hours before you put the boxes with the organ in the transport box. Keep the lid on the transport box all the time.

We recommend that the organs are stored in the transport box until they are used.

Se separate cooling diagram for pre cooling on www.medco.no

Cooling elements directly from the household freezer:

You can also take the cooling elements directly from the freezer (- 22C) while taking the organs into the transport box.

We recommend that the organs are stored in the transport box until they are used.

*Fill up with your cold perfusion

When the wrapped kidney has been placed in the inner container, with the discs fill it to the brim with your cold perfusion fluid. Fill up with your cold perfusion to the disc on the top floats higher than the edge of the inner container

Page 15: User manuals for untrimmed kidney transport- and storing  kit

*Tighten the lid

Tighten the lid firmly and dry off any liquid on the surface of the inner container

Page 16: User manuals for untrimmed kidney transport- and storing  kit

*Place the inner container into the outer protection box

Place the inner container with the kidney into the outer protection box, and snap the lid shut.

*Now place it immediately in the MEDCO cooling box or in a fridge to store until transplantation.

Here you see the transport box ready to be closed, with kidney container , vessel container, cooling elements.

In the room to the left, paper and blood samples.

Page 19: User manuals for untrimmed kidney transport- and storing  kit

*Slide the sterile inner container carefully into the sterile environment.

When ready to transplant the kidney, take it out of the cooler.

Then take off the snap lid and slide the sterile inner container carefully into the sterile environment.
